there are certain stadiums that seem to score with a bias towards certain items....

Balt, Buff and Mia have been sorta notorious for giving out oodles of assists

Philly is extremely notorious for giving out Pass Defenses

 

but with regards to ray age will catch up to him i just dont think its this yr

with Urlacher the loss of tank could hurt and will hurt some but he will still get his
